It shows me also that most of your plugins would have problems with 2.3. After I upgraded WP and your plugins I thought that wouldn't be the case anymore. But still it shows for some plugins
"Possibly incompatible: upgrade-functions.php?"
A reference was found to "wp-admin/upgrade-functions.php", which has been moved and renamed to "wp-admin/include/upgrade.php" in WordPress 2.3. It is possible that a check is being made to be compatible with old and current versions of WordPress. If a file also references "include/upgrade.php", we assume it is checking compatibility itself and do not mark it as being possibly incompatible.
